Subject: Date localization cut-over done

Team — the Harrowgate cut-over finished last night. All user-facing dates now render through the new locale service; the old format strings are removed. Two regressions found and fixed: Finnish week numbering and the archive export header. Rollback window closes Friday. No further action needed from most of you. The settings now live in production follow.

config for yajep-tafof:
[rusath]
team = julmir
access_code = ac_fe37fd
host = rusath.novactech.test
port = 8000
owner = pelmir.weneth
peer = oliwyn.olvarqdyn.internal

Step 4: Load-test the checkout flow

Before promoting the new Cartwheel checkout service, run the standard load profile against the Verdane staging pool. Use the same ramp schedule as the Q2 exercise: ten minutes warm-up, thirty minutes sustained, five minutes spike. Confirm that payment-intent retries stay under one percent and that the cart-lock pool does not saturate. Hold the release gate until these numbers are reviewed. The load generator should be started with the following settings.

config for kafof-bawef:
holath:
  log_level: debug
  metrics_host: metrics.holath.qorvelsys.internal
  pin: 2191
  pool_size: 32

### 2.8.1 — Key rotation

Rotated the alerting credentials for the Lundqvist read-replica lag alarm after the quarterly audit flagged them as stale. The alarm itself is unchanged: it still fires when replica lag on the Tellvane cluster exceeds 45 seconds. Support should expect no behavioral difference, only new signatures on alert payloads. Alerts are now verified against the following key.

deploy key for kajof-fajop: bky6_gDHw9Q

Subject: Key rotation — FD-hunt tooling

Hi,

As part of the Burrowscope leaked-file-descriptor hunt, we rotated credentials for the diagnostics collector, since the old key appeared in several captured core dumps. The hunt itself continues; collector agents on the release fleet were redeployed overnight and are reporting normally. Please update the release pipeline secrets before the next cut. The new key for the diagnostics collector service is below.

service key, fawip-bajef: kto11_Qt5wZK9vdNC